Singer Tems Secures Second Grammy Award in the U.S.

Nigerian singer Temilade Openiyi popularly known as Tems has emerged as the winner of the Best African Music Performance category at the 67th Grammy awards in the United States.

Tem’s song titled: “Love Me Jeje,” was adjudged as the winner of the category after she saw off other strong nominees including; Burna Boy’s “Higher,” Asake’s MMS, Yemi Alade’s “Tomorrow” and Chris Brown’s “Sensational” featuring Davido and Lojay.

This is the second time that the sensation singer is going home with a Grammy award following her first award for her contribution to the hit single “Wait For U’” waxed by American rapper Future.

Moments after Tems emerged as the winner of the Best African Music Performance category at the music awards staged at Los Angeles on Sunday night, Davido and Ayra Starr took to X (formerly Twitter) to react to the singer’s feat.

In his post on the social media platform, Davido congratulated Tems and also sent a warm message to his friend, Chris Brown for winning the Best R&B album category.

“Congratulations to my one and only G.O.A.T @chrisbrown. And to my queen @temsbaby. We are proud of you.” Davido wrote on X.

In her message to Tems on X, Ayra Starr wrote: “Temssbabyyyyyyy. Congratulations my love.”
